I'm using the following code for the 2 borders of different colors, and space between the borders. I'm using the property outline-offset
for the space between the borders. However it is not supported in IE (not even IE9).
Is there any alternate solution which works in the IE as well, without adding another div in the html.
HTML:
<div class="box"></div>
CSS:
.box{
width: 100px;
height: 100px;
margin: 100px;
border: 2px solid green;
outline:2px solid red;
outline-offset: 2px;
}
The height and width is not fixed, i have just used for the example.
